Output 99379973f0684f7e6f7c3c5aaa8d7e55c5dabddefb49526486f4461c82c476ad:156

value
144584
script pubkey
OP_0 OP_PUSHBYTES_20 b312216922a3899c80a66f3435d77bd7a56edd97
address
bc1qkvfzz6fz5wyeeq9xdu6rt4mm67jkahvhpq9s09
transaction
99379973f0684f7e6f7c3c5aaa8d7e55c5dabddefb49526486f4461c82c476ad
confirmations
12613
spent
true